Help topics give incorrect instructions for how to install support for other languages in Publisher 2002

SUMMARY

In Microsoft Publisher Help, the following topics do not provide the correct instructions for how to install support for other languages on your computer:
  • Add multilanguage support
  • Add Asian and Pan-European language support

MORE INFORMATION

To install multilanguage support, follow these steps:
  1. Click Start, point to Settings, and then click Control Panel.

    NOTE: In Microsoft Windows XP, click Start and then click Control Panel.
  2. Open Add/Remove Programs.
  3. Click Microsoft Internet Explorer 5 and Internet Tools.
  4. Click Add/Remove.
  5. Click Add a Component.
  6. Scroll to the bottom of the components list, and then click to select the check boxes for the languages for which you want to add support.
  7. Click Next.
  8. After Microsoft Windows completes installing the components, click Finish.
  9. Restart the computer.
